Top Luxury Resorts in the Kansai Region Featuring Onsen and Premium Service

The Kansai region of Japan, renowned for its rich cultural heritage and stunning landscapes, is also home to some of the most luxurious resorts that offer an unparalleled experience of relaxation and rejuvenation. Among these, the Arima Onsen area stands out, particularly with the iconic Arima Grand Hotel. This resort not only boasts a prime location near the historic hot springs but also provides guests with a blend of traditional Japanese hospitality and modern luxury. The onsen facilities here are exceptional, featuring both indoor and outdoor baths that allow visitors to soak in mineral-rich waters while enjoying bre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ains. The hotel’s commitment to premium service is evident in its attentive staff, who are trained to anticipate guests’ needs, ensuring a seamless and memorable stay.

Moving further into the heart of the Kansai region, the Aman Kyoto offers a unique blend of tranquility and sophistication. Nestled within a serene forest, this resort is designed to harmonize with its natural surroundings, providing a peaceful retreat from the bustling city life. The onsen experience at Aman Kyoto is particularly noteworthy, as it incorporates traditional Japanese bathing rituals into its wellness offerings. Guests can indulge in private onsen baths that are meticulously crafted to enhance relaxation and rejuvenation. The resort’s dedication to premium service is reflected in its personalized wellness programs, which are tailored to meet the individual needs of each guest, ensuring a holistic approach to relaxation.

In the vibrant city of Osaka, the InterContinental Osaka stands as a beacon of luxury and comfort. While it may not be a traditional onsen resort, it offers a unique spa experience that incorporates elements of Japanese wellness. The hotel features a luxurious spa that includes a private onsen suite, allowing guests to enjoy the therapeutic benefits of hot springs in an urban setting. The InterContinental Osaka is also known for its exceptional dining options, with restaurants that serve both local and international cuisine, all prepared with the finest ingredients. The attentive staff ensures that every aspect of the guest experience is elevated, from the moment of check-in to the final farewell.

Traveling to the picturesque town of Nara, the Nara Hotel presents a blend of historical charm and modern luxury. This hotel, which has hosted numerous dignitaries and celebrities, offers a unique onsen experience that reflects the region’s rich cultural heritage. The onsen facilities are designed to provide a serene atmosphere, allowing guests to unwind while soaking in the soothing waters. The Nara Hotel is also renowned for its exceptional service, with staff members who are well-versed in the art of hospitality, ensuring that every guest feels valued and cared for during their stay.

Lastly, the Ritz-Carlton, Kyoto, epitomizes luxury with its stunning views of the Kamo River and the surrounding mountains. This resort features an exquisite onsen experience that combines traditional Japanese aesthetics with modern amenities. Guests can enjoy the tranquility of the onsen while being pampered by the hotel’s dedicated staff, who are committed to providing a level of service that exceeds expectations. The Ritz-Carlton, Kyoto also offers a range of culinary experiences, showcasing the best of Kyoto’s seasonal ingredients, further enhancing the luxurious experience that this resort has to offer. Each of these resorts in the Kansai region not only provides access to rejuvenating onsen but also exemplifies the highest standards of premium service, making them ideal destinations for those seeking an indulgent escape.

What is the best time to visit luxury onsen resorts in Kansai?

The best time to visit is during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) when the weather is mild and the scenery is beautiful. These seasons also offer unique seasonal experiences, such as cherry blossoms and autumn foliage.
